Fiduciary collateral as a type of collateral gives the rights of executorial to creditors to do parate execution on the object of fiduciary collateral when a debtor defaults. In practice, however, collateral misuses this right illegally. This becomes the basics for Judicial Review agains Article 15, paraghraphs 2 and 3 of Law No. 42/1999, and the Constitutional Court issued the Ruling No. 18/PUU-XVII/2019. Therefore in this thesis the formulation of the problem raised is first, when a debtor is considered to have committed an act of default, and secondly, it delves into the creditor's execution procedure and the ratio decidendi related to Constitutional Court Decision No. 18/PUU-XVII/2019. The research use descriptive juridicial normative method. The data were gathered by conducting library research. The result of the analysis shows that Ruling does not impede the right of executing by creditors so that it is in accordance with the executorial right in fiduciary collateral. So, there are two possible ways for a debtor to be declared in default: firstly, the agreement of default is stipulated during the main agreement and the initial fiduciary collateral agreement. Secondly, the default is determined by the district court in order to execute the fiduciary collateral object.

Balerina Fashion faces the problem of waste in production process activities, which is caused by errors in pattern cutting, repetitive activities between production stages, and double work in the Quality Control (QC) division. This study aims to improve the efficiency of the production process by reducing waste using the Lean Manufacturing approach through the Value Stream Mapping (VSM) and Process Activity Mapping (PAM) methods. The results showed a significant increase in Value Adding (VA) time, from 56.00% to 84.88%. In contrast, Non-Value Adding (NVA) time decreased dramatically from 35.74% to 3.33%, while Necessary Non-Value Adding (NNVA) time increased slightly from 8.25% to 11.79%. These changes reflect productivity improvements and an increased focus on activities that provide direct value to customers. As a recommendation, the development of a new Standard Operating Procedure (SOP) is suggested to ensure each process runs according to standard. This SOP includes a detailed step-by-step guide for operators and QC, which was previously unavailable.

The Halal Product Guarantee Administering Body (BPJPH) is an official institution that has been authorized based on the mandate of Law no. 30 of 2014 concerning Halal Product Guarantees. BPJPH has high authority in implementing halal certification. Halal certification is mandatory for halal business actors in Indonesia. This research aims to find out how the halal certification process is carried out by BPJPH and the reasons behind why BPJPH implements regulations like this. The research method used is qualitative with a juridical or normative legal approach. This research is included in library research or library research by reviewing literature that is appropriate to the research object. The data sources used are the Halal Product Guarantee Law (UU JPH) and its derivatives and the official BPJPH account which is normative and can be accessed by the public. The research results show that halal certification by BPJPH is carried out in two ways, namely independently/regularly and self-declare. Each has a different halal certification flow. The legal basis for implementing halal certification by BPJPH is Law no. 30 of 2014 concerning Halal Product Guarantees, Government Regulation Number 31 of 2019 concerning Implementation of Halal Product Guarantees, Minister of Religion Regulation Number 26 of 2019 concerning Procedures for Halal Certification, and BPJPH Regulation Number 61 of 2022 concerning SOPs for Halal Certificate Application Services at BPJPH.

Background: Respiratory failure is a condition in which the respiratory system fails to perform the function of gas exchange, namely the entry of oxygen and the exit of carbon dioxide. Patients with respiratory failure are usually put on a ventilator. Patients who are put on a ventilator will experience a buildup of secretions, to overcome this, chest physiotherapy and suction will be performed. Chest physiotherapy is a procedure performed on patients who experience secretion retention and oxygenation disorders who require assistance to thin or remove secretions. While suction is the act of inserting a suction catheter tube through the mouth or nose or endotracheal tube (ETT) which aims to reduce sputum retention, free the airway and prevent lung infections. The purpose of this community service is to teach and understand changes in oxygen saturation levels in patients with respiratory failure in the ICU room of the Dr. Ario Wirawan Salatiga Lung Hospital after chest physiotherapy and suction interventions. The methods used are training, lectures and direct demonstrations. The number of patients in this community service is 4 patients. The results of this community service are the effect of increasing oxygen saturation after chest physiotherapy and suction. That is, before chest physiotherapy, the average oxygen saturation level was 93%, after chest physiotherapy for 3 days it became 97%. While before suction, the average saturation level was 95%, after suction for 3 days the 4th saturation became 100%. The conclusion is that there is an increase in oxygen saturation levels after chest physiotherapy and suction in patients with respiratory failure in the ICU Room of the Dr. Ario Wirawan Salatiga Lung Hospital.

General Election (Pemilu) is a fundamental pillar of democracy that often faces various challenges, including legal violations that undermine its integrity. To overcome this, the Integrated Law Enforcement Center (Gakkumdu) was formed as a collaboration between Bawaslu, the Police, and the Attorney General's Office to accelerate the handling of election violations. However, the strict handling time limit of 14 working days is a major challenge in achieving fair and effective decisions. This study aims to evaluate the effectiveness of the handling time of election violations by Gakkumdu and identify the inhibiting factors. Using a descriptive-analytical qualitative method, this study found that the main obstacles include inter-agency coordination, sectoral ego, limited human resources, and lack of supporting technology. In addition, differences in legal interpretation and low public legal awareness also slowed down the enforcement process. In conclusion, the effectiveness of Gakkumdu handling time is not optimal and requires policy reform. Recommendations include simplifying procedures, cross-agency training, utilizing technology, and educating the public. These reforms are expected to improve election integrity and support a fairer democracy.

Pronunciation in a second language (L2) is often influenced by the first language (L1), which can hinder intelligibility. Indonesian speakers struggle with certain English sounds, such as /θ/ and /ð/, due to their absence in the L1 phonetic system. To identify the influence of L1 on L2 pronunciation in the context of English language learning in Indonesia and propose strategies to reduce negative transfer effects. This qualitative study used a case study approach, involving 9 students from an English club at XYZ School. A pronunciation test was conducted to measure phonetic transfer between L1 and L2. Results show that L1 phonetic transfer causes errors in specific phonemes. Words with higher phonetic complexity are more challenging to pronounce correctly. Negative phonetic transfer and a lack of prosodic training were identified as major obstacles. Context-based and intensive phonetic training significantly improves pronunciation skills. L2 pronunciation errors are strongly influenced by L1, phonetic complexity, and individual experience. Contextual learning and individualized approaches positively impact pronunciation improvement.
